  • Kamil E. Armaiz Nolla

    I started at Seichou Karate in 2009. However, after a brief hiatus, I was able to come back to Seichou Karate, and restart at the high of the pandemic by taking virtual classes thanks to the dedication Shihan Romero has with his students. Shihan Romero's expertise in Japanese Karate, culture, and language creates the perfect environment and a well-rounded karate school. In addition to karate, you can learn Japanese calligraphy and celebrate Japanese traditions. Shihan Romero and his excellent group of teachers, who have been personally trained by him, impart Seichou Karate classes. They make sure students reach excellency in their skills including basic form, movement patterns, and fighting techniques before taking their promotion tests which happen twice a year. Seichou Karate is the place where I found grounding, increased my focus, and every single time class ends I am a happier person and look forward to my next class.
